I pulled my analog cluster along with the dash to replace lights, install 3.5" mids, install new dash plaque and clean up a bunch of unused wires from a previous owner. Got everything back together and noticed a black rubber nipple (hears your chance Charlie and Earl) in the floorboard. My gas gauge was not working right after reinstalling everything. Had a 1/8 tank left but gauge was showing 1/2. I took the cluster apart again to see if I could figure out where it goes, no luck. I tried putting the nipple on the 3 posts for the gas gauge. I put it on bottom left and it appeared to be about right on the fuel level. I went and put 6 gallons in it and it did not move at all. Putting it on the right side makes it go way past full. Top post makes bottom past empty. W/o it all it's even at the full mark. My sender has been replaced in the past 3 months and works perfect. Everything else cluster wise works right. Anybody know what's up with it?
 
Think I got working now by unplugging the sender at the pump then reinstalling the gauge w/o the nipple thingy.
